Hey guys I have a 92 Rockhopper, that was given to me with the condiion that if I wanted it gone that it was gifted to someone else.
A mate was given this bike by a customer because he did not want to fix it, then my mate gave it to one of his mates, who in turn gave it to a mate of his, it came up for give away again and I took it.
All of the other guys had meant to turn it into a single speed because of it semi horizontal drop outs, so I thought it only fitting that I actually do a SS conversion, first one on a MTB.
So . . . I have some cranks , figure it best to use road cranks for the fouling caused by lower chain ring mounts on chain stay.
Square taper:
Exage Road
105 Retro (on there now with a 115mm BB)
Double ring on road cranks as apposed to triple means no lower chain ring mount fouling)
Deore 5 arm
Deore 4 arm
XT 5 arm
Splined:
Deore
Tiagra
FSA (Road)
The 1050 5 arm 130 pcd cranks on there at the moment are about 1 - 1.5mm away from non drive side stay.
The chain line will need the rear cog spaced towards the drop out end of freehub body rather than the middle as most of the road conversions I have done.
Question's,
1) Does it matter about being that close to the stay on the non drive side?
2) Who makes cheapish steel 38 tooth 4 arm cranks model FC-M510?
Suggestions on which you think welcomed.
